Books are investments that are, most of the time, found stacked or kept in a room. For book lovers, keeping paperbacks and hardbacks close to them is precious; and an interesting way to show how much they love their hobby is to decorate a book-inspired room with the use of canvas prints.
Printing canvas is a cheap solution and can be practically used for redecorating your room. With just a few ideas on filling up your room with book designs, you can turn your room instantly into a book haven, and easily remove and reuse them long after.
1. Shelf Art: By printing an art graphic representation of a line of books, you can have a floating bookshelf effect on your walls. Your online printing company is capable of producing horizontal-shaped canvases that can very well represent a longer book display. This concept can look good at the very middle part of a wall. Print the canvas long enough to pass across the wall for the décor to appear more realistic.
2. Vintage Page Prints: Another can be a replica of an old book page printed on canvas. This display can also be a favorite page or chapter you like. The effect of an olden page on canvas can appear realistic because of the crumpled finishing of the material used.
3. Book pages: Another accent you can use, find a photo of a stack of books or produce a design of such, then have them printed for wall display too. You can have these designs appear as gigantic stacks of books, which will look good somewhere around the lower area of your room.
